SUBJECT: Amendment No. 4 to Professional Services Agreement 230252B with Universal Protection Services, LP, dba Allied Universal Security Services
RECOMMENDATION
title
Approve and authorize Amendment No. 4 to Agreement No. 230252B with Universal Protection Services, LP, dba Allied Universal Security Services, to update the scope of work to add a posted security guard at the South Campus Building B and increase maximum compensation for routine services due to this increase in services effective February 2, 2025. (Fiscal Impact: $30,022 Expense; HHSA Fund; Budgeted; Discretionary)
body
BACKGROUND
Approval of Amendment No. 4 to Agreement No. 230252B will update the scope of work to include routine posted security services at 2751 Napa Valley Corporate Drive, Bldg. B during regular business hours. Health and Human Services has identified the need for a consistent safety presence in Building B. Building A currently has posted security staff.
The maximum compensation for each fiscal year beginning FY 24/25 will increase to accommodate this additional posted security guard location. Maximum compensation for non-routine services will remain the same. Maximum compensation under the agreement will increase by $30,022 in FY 2024-25 for a new maximum of $576,051, increase to $640,805 in FY 2025-26, and increase to $658,913 in FY 2026-27.
On October 17, 2023, the Board approved Amendment 3 to the agreement to update the scope of work to include routine posted security services in the lobby of the County Administration Building thereby increasing maximum compensation to $505,931 in FY 2023-24 and $546,029 in FY 2024-25. Maximum compensation increased in optional contract years 4-5 to $563,845 in FY 2025-26, and $579,644 in FY 2026-27
